U.S. and Japan Discuss $13 Billion Display Factory to Counter Chinese Dominance

What's Happening? The United States and Japan are reportedly in discussions regarding the establishment of a state-backed, next-generation display factory in the U.S., to be operated by Japan Display Inc. (JDI). This potential investment could be valued at up to $13 billion and is part of a broader
